摘 要:为研究冬季辐射和对流换热形成的非均匀环境对人体热舒适的影响,通过对20名受试者在不同空调形式(对流空调、辐射地板空调、辐射吊顶空调等)及个人舒适系统(personal comfort system, PCS)多工况下生理参数和主观反应的实验研究,建立了非均匀环境中不同工况下考虑局部影响权重的人体热感觉评价模型。结果表明:不同空调形式下局部热感觉对整体热感觉影响权重不同;3种空调形式下不使用PCS时远窗侧人员最冷部位(足部)热感觉投票值均高于近窗侧,全体人员足部热感觉投票值在辐射地板空调中最高。使用PCS可提升局部热感觉和热舒适,局部热感觉提升最显著部位分别是肩胛部(对流)、腹部(辐射地板)和大腿(辐射吊顶);此外,PCS可以降低人员期望温度,在辐射地板组合PCS时期望温度变化最大。In order to study the influence of non-uniform environment formed by radiation and convective heat transfer in winter on human thermal comfort,physiological parameters and subjective responses of 20 subjects under different air conditioning forms(convection air conditioning,radiant floor air conditioning,radiant ceiling air conditioning,etc.)and personal comfort systems(PCS)were experimentally studied.An evaluation model of human thermal sensation considering local influence weight under different working conditions in non-uniform environment was established.The results show that under different conditions,the influence weights of local thermal sensation on overall thermal sensation are different.In the three forms of air conditioning,the thermal sensation voting value of the coldest part(feet)at the far window side is higher than that at the near window side without PCS,and the thermal sensation voting value of the feet of all personnel is the highest in the radiant floor air conditioning.PCS can improve local thermal sensation and thermal comfort,and the most significant improvement of local thermal sensation is shoulder blade(convection),abdomen(radiant floor)and thigh(radiant ceiling).In addition,PCS can reduce preferred temperature,with the greatest change in expected temperature when PCS is combined with radiant floors.
